Abstract
The main reason of this thesis is to characterize and compare bulk and surface properties of magnetic nanostructures: Ni2MnGa Heusler alloys, amorphous and nanocrystalline FeSiNbCuB ribbons, magnetic nanopowders and liquids. Method for measuring bulk magnetic properties is based on the vibrating sample magnetometer VSM whose function and principle is going to be described in detail. Methods for determining the surface magneto-optical properties are the following: differential intensity method due to which the surface hysteresis loops are measured, and Kerr microscopy, which is used for the magnetic domains observation.
